Hi,

I can confirm that the windows key can not be used for a user-defined keyboard shortcut on a fresh install of Linux Mint 14 Nadia (and did not work on Mint 13 Maya either). Also, the above-mentioned workaround does not work.

However, on Linux Mint 13 Maya, the following workaround worked:

Code: Select all

sudo apt-get install gconf-editor
start it up, and then in the tabs navigate to

Code: Select all

apps->metacity->global_keybindings and keybinding_commands
The two parameters did the trick together with the windows key written as <Super>. Well, so I tried this again in Mint 14, but alas, there is no metacity key anymore in gconf-editor. Is there a way to get this key back?

Also, I tried using

Code: Select all

xfce4-keyboard-settings
which had been suggested elsewhere but that, too, did not work for me to assign a keyboard shortcut to the windows key.

Any ideas?

Post by dyfet »

This bug hit me too. I am starting a package of tiny x11 helper apps (http://dev.gnutelephony.org/gitweb/?p=p ... ;a=summary) to do some window management functions that are currently missing in muffin and sometimes elsewhere, starting with one to simply "rotate" workspaces, since the built-in ones for muffin only has options to go left/right, rather than going back to ws 0 after reaching the end of the list. On xfce4 (xfwm has this feature) I normally bind this functionality to super-tab (and rotate back to super-backtab), and really the choice was from kde which uses super-tab to rotate activities...

Anyway yes, creating new custom shortcuts from cinnamon's keyboard control do not seem to work as noted here, though any of the existing built-in muffin/cinnamon shortcuts can be re-pogrammed. New custom keyboard entries can be created instead from gnome control center keyboard control, also as noted in this thread, but they behave strangely if you assign super as part of the sequence. At best, if I hold down super, and press tab twice, it worked, and then kept jumping as expected so long as I kept holding down super and hit tab again after... I decided to assign to control-tab instead :), and that works fine...

I'm using an Apple keyboard & was able to rectify some weirdness here:
System Settings>Keyboard, then on the bottom right is a button that says "Layout Settings"
Under the "Layouts" tab, you can make sure you have the correct keyboard selected, and test all of the keys, w/visual feedback. Then from there, if you click "Options..." on the bottom right, there are a LOT of settings regarding Command, Super, Alt, Ctrl, etc.

Although my Command key still seems to not work in combination with any letter keys or Space.

But I'm STILL having key command issues as well. They work in a way that any tech hates to hear, "intermittently". Usually, the pre-defined ones seem ok, and the ones I set up w/arrow & number keys for workspace & window management seem ok. But for example, I have Alt + w to launch Firefox, and sometimes, it doesn't work. Sometimes, it works after a few tries. And sometimes, it works when I hold the keys for a bit. I can't make any sense out of it, & hope it'll get fixed in an update.

It's fixed in Mint 15 Cinnamon. Thankyou Mint development team!
  • Cinnamon Settings>Switch to Advanced Mode>Keyboard>Keyboard shortcuts>Custom Shortcuts>Add custom shortcut
  • Enter a name and choose a command to run
  • Click "unassigned" twice
  • Press the key combination you want to assign to your shortcut
